Title When race becomes real : black and white writers confront their personal histories / edited by Bernestine Singley ; epilogue by Derrick Bell.
Publication Info. Chicago : Lawrence Hill Books, c2002.

Edition 1st ed.
Description xvi, 335 p. : ports. ; 24 cm.
Bibliography Includes bibliographical references.
Contents Introduction / by Bernestine Singley -- Genesis. Race story / Jim Schutze. Crazy sometimes / Leonard Pitts, Jr. Experiences and memories / Robert Cole. The night I stopped being a negro / Les Payne. Son of the south / John Seigenthaler, Sr. Talking white / Kimberly Springer. Central Park samaritan / Natalie Angier. It all started with my parents / Lucy Gibson -- Fear and longing. Race, rage, and the Ace of Spades / Julianne Malveaux. To make them stand in fear / David Bradley. Passing / Theresa M. Towner. Black and white / Robert Jensen. For colored girls who have resisted homogenization when the rainbow ain't enough / Joycelyn K. Moody. Anatomy of a fairy princess / Patricia J. Williams. A rambling response to the play Marie Christine / Kalamu ya Salaam. Black, white, and seeing red all over / Shawn E. Rhea. Race fatigue / Ira J. Hadnot -- Exodus. Choosing to be black : the ultimate white privilege? / Beverly Daniel Tatum. White like me : race and identity through majority eyes / Tim Wise. Traveling with white people / Colleen J. McElroy. Race : a discussion in ten parts, plus a few moments of unsubstantiated theory and one inarguable fact / Kiini Ibura Salaam. A funky fresh talented tenth / Touré. On acting white : mother-daughter talk / Lisa Dodson and Odessa Dorian Cole. Country music / Susan Straight. One summer evening / Noel Ignatiev. Spelling lesson / Carlton Winfrey. Jasper, Texas elegy / Bernestine Singley. All souls : civil rights from Southie to Soweto and back / Michael Patrick MacDonald. Pictures in black and white / Hanna Griffiths.
Subject United States -- Race relations -- Anecdotes.
Racism -- United States -- Anecdotes.
African American authors -- Biography -- Anecdotes.
African Americans -- Race identity -- Anecdotes.
African Americans -- Social conditions -- Anecdotes.
Authors, American -- Biography -- Anecdotes.
Whites -- Race identity -- United States -- Anecdotes.
Whites -- United States -- Social conditions -- Anecdotes.
Added Author Singley, Bernestine.
